Blueberry Hibiscus Lemonade

Blueberry Hibiscus Lemonade isn’t just a refreshing drink. It’s made with antioxidant rich ingredients like whole blueberries and real hibiscus flowers. Go ahead…take a sip!
Prep time.3 minutes
Cook time.7 minutes
Total time.10 minutes
Course.Drinks
Cuisine.American
Number of servings.6
Calories per serving.116 kcal

Ingredients

  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up water
  • ¼ cup dried hibiscus flowers
  • ¾ cup wild blueberries, fresh or frozen
  • 4 cups filtered water
  • 1 cup lemon juice, fresh squeezed

Instructions

  • Combine sugar and water in a saucepan over medium heat and stir until the sugar is dissolved. Add dried hibiscus flowers and blueberries to the pan and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at and simmer for 3 to 4 minutes. Use a wooden spoon to gently press unpeopled blueberries to release their juices.
  • Strain the liquid through a fine mesh strainer into a measuring cup or pitcher and cool.
  • Once cool, combine the syrup with filtered water and lemon juice and stir well. Refrigerate until cold. Serve over ice.
